Switches
Description
-Bfilename.ext
File name that contains the agent. This file is expected to be in the
Motorola S1:S9 format.
-Mfilename.ext
File name that contains the miniboot agent. This file is expected to
be in the Motorola S1:S9 format.
-Vx
Verbose mode, where x =
0: no reports of progress
1: every step of the loading process is displayed on the screen
-Lx
Load boot loader, where x =
0: the boot loader is assumed to be in memory
1: the boot loader is loaded
-Ax
Binary mode, where x =
0: Executive image will be sent in ASCII S1:S9 format
1: the executive image is sent to the module in binary mode
instead of ASCII S1:S9 format. This reduces the number of
characters sent to the module to approximately one-half or the
original.
-Wx
Load agent, where x =
0: load the agent into the module at 9600 baud
1: load the agent into the module at 38400 baud. When -W1 is
used in conjuction with –A1, the agent is loaded as fast as is
possible.
-Px
Com port, where x =
1:
com port 1 is used to communicate to the module
not 1: com port 2 is used
EXAMPLE
-INJECT -V1 -Rregs.s0 -Bbooter.0 -F1 –Cscud.mot -A0 -L1 -W1 – P2
Loads the file regs.s0 into the configuration registers of the Duet’s 68HC11. The file booter.0 is loaded
into the module to accept the executive image. The file scud.mot is loaded in as the executive image.
The executive is loaded in the binary mode at 38400 baud. The booter is loaded into memory at 19200
baud using Com2.
